Worn-Out Roofing shingles
When you see your roof's tiles crinkling, splitting, or missing, it's a clear indication they're broken. Worn-out roof shingles can lead to larger issues down the line, so addressing this concern quickly is vital.
Tiles typically have a life-span of 20 to three decades, yet variables like climate condition, improper setup, and lack of maintenance can reduce that life.
You'll intend to inspect your roof covering consistently, particularly after serious tornados or harsh weather. If you see indications of wear, it's time to take action.
Replacing worn-out roof shingles not just boosts your roof's look but also shields your home from possible damage brought on by leaks or dampness seepage.

Roofing Leaks
Roofing leakages can creep up on you, commonly going unnoticed till they cause considerable damages. They can stem from different sources, such as harmed roof shingles, worn-out flashing, or perhaps incorrect installment. If you observe water discolorations on your ceiling or walls, it's a clear indicator that something's incorrect.
You must regularly inspect your roofing for any missing or fractured roof shingles. These little problems can cause larger issues if left unchecked. Pay attention to areas around chimneys, vents, and skylights, as these are common leakage factors.
Don't forget to examine your seamless gutters, as well. Clogged seamless gutters can bring about water pooling on the roof covering, which raises the danger of leaks. If you suspect a leakage, act rapidly. Ignoring it might mean expensive fixings down the line.

Poor Drainage Issues
Water pooling on your roofing can lead to serious issues, commonly originating from poor drainage. This water can leak into your roof products, bring about leaks and prospective architectural damage.
You should consistently inspect your seamless gutters and downspouts to guarantee they're clear of debris. Clogged rain gutters can create water to back up and overflow, developing additional stress on your roofing system.
It's also important to check for any kind of drooping areas where water might collect. If you see these problems, it's vital to resolve them without delay.
You could consider adding added drainage systems, like scuppers or roofing drains pipes, to boost water flow. Buying a specialist assessment can expose underlying concerns that you might miss out on.
